Create a photobucket account. Upload the photos to that account.

When you want to show them in your CF posts, link to them by putting the path to the photo in between [IMG] & [/IMG] or simply click on the icon that looks like and paste the link in the text box.

The key here is that you can't upload a picture directly to Corvette Forum by pasting it into a post.

You don't need a PhotoBucket account. You can link to any external web site that you can upload your pictures to. After you get your picture uploaded, read the post by 96GS#007.

If you click on the "Go Advanced" button below the Quick Reply message box you can preview your post and see what it looks like with the pic linked into it.
